These printables are to be displayed around your classroom for your third grade students.

Students at this level are asked to have a greater stretch of the imagination with their reading and vocabulary memory. Students want to know how a prefix works and what it does to modify the action or meaning of a word. This is also the first time students come across homophones. Curiosity is at an all time high at this age because creative side of the brain and mechanical side of the brain are finally kicking in at the same time. By grade 3 we start to begin to expect students to be able to use context clues to determine the meaning of words that they do not know, but it is also still imperative that there are words that they just know from sight. Grade 3 is where is encourage students to start building their synonym libraries this starts at the context level but could always include the use of thesauruses and or a dictionary. 3rd grade is the year when students first have to have reading recall and the concept of comprehension really gets going. These word walls lead students towards this skill and gives them a breadth of help for recall.

Word walls are powerful tools for early learning. These are a must in every classroom throughout the school level. The new words that kids learn from visual learning can lessen the teacher’s burden, and a student becomes more independent in knowledge.

To aid teachers and parents with the list of new vocabulary for the 3rd-grade word wall words, we have carefully created a list that includes all the words taught in the year ahead and the recap of the 2nd grade so that the familiar words boost their confidence.
